// GetNodesHealthCheckPort returns the health check port used by the GCE load
// balancers (l4) for performing health checks on nodes.
func GetNodesHealthCheckPort() int32 {
return lbNodesHealthCheckPort
}
// getNodesHealthCheckPath returns the health check path used by the GCE load
// balancers (l4) for performing health checks on nodes.
func getNodesHealthCheckPath() string {
return nodesHealthCheckPath
}
// makeNodesHealthCheckName returns name of the health check resource used by
// the GCE load balancers (l4) for performing health checks on nodes.
func makeNodesHealthCheckName(clusterID string) string {
return fmt.Sprintf("k8s-%v-node", clusterID)
}
// MakeHealthCheckFirewallName returns the firewall name used by the GCE load
// balancers (l4) for performing health checks.
func MakeHealthCheckFirewallName(clusterID, hcName string, isNodesHealthCheck bool) string {
if isNodesHealthCheck {
// TODO: Change below fwName to match the proposed schema: k8s-{clusteriD}-{namespace}-{name}-{shortid}-hc.
return makeNodesHealthCheckName(clusterID) + "-http-hc"
}
return "k8s-" + hcName + "-http-hc"
}
// isAtLeastMinNodesHealthCheckVersion checks if a version is higher than
// `minNodesHealthCheckVersion`.
func isAtLeastMinNodesHealthCheckVersion(vstring string) bool {
version, err := utilversion.ParseGeneric(vstring)
if err != nil {
glog.Errorf("vstring (%s) is not a valid version string: %v", vstring, err)
return false
}
return version.AtLeast(minNodesHealthCheckVersion)
}
// supportsNodesHealthCheck returns false if anyone of the nodes has version
// lower than `minNodesHealthCheckVersion`.
func supportsNodesHealthCheck(nodes []*v1.Node) bool {
for _, node := range nodes {
if !isAtLeastMinNodesHealthCheckVersion(node.Status.NodeInfo.KubeProxyVersion) {
return false
}
}
return true
}
